MDEQ collects public comments on permitting of Stone Treated

MDEQ HEARING — MDEQ held a public hearing Tuesday night where community members had a chance to express their resistance to the permit application made by Stone Treated Materials to reopen. Concerns ranged from possible pollution of the local drainage tributaries and the alleged health problems that could be associated. Many hearing attendees shared stories of how their family members are believed to have suffered fatal illnesses due to the pollution. (Photo by Jeremy Pittari)
